Andy Murray is playing some fantastic season in the last year or so. That also refers to the grass courts, where he is still unharmed this season. He recorded 9 consecutive wins on this surface after Roland Garros was over, firstly winning the home tournament in Queens, beating Seppi, Garcia Lopez, Fish, Ferrero and Blake in the finals. His grass form is probably at its peak right now, which proves the fact he won the Queens without a set lost. Now, at the great Wimbledon he has a very difficult job of justifying the home crowd expectations. They’re all giving him an incredible support, giving him the wings to every win. The only major problems he faced so far were against great Stan Wawrinka, who he defeated in five sets. With that win he tied his best result at Wimbledon, and of course nobody expects him to stop yet, as he, and the whole U.K. have the ambitions of winning the title. U.K. hasn’t had such a great player in a while, so all eyes are set on the 22-yr old Murray, and a true Andymonium was created even before this Grand Slam started.
Juan Carlos Ferrero is just a step away from tying his best result at this Grand Slam, which is the semifinals. He will be facing the home player, almost unbeatable Andy Murray. Clay courts have always been something he preferred more, even managing to win Roland Garros once in his long career. He hasn’t recorded too many impressive results on grass, something people would never expected from a former number one in the world. He is currently 69th in the rankings, but once used to be the first, and the last time that was the case was back on September 8th, 2003. Everyone was surprised by the fact this 29-yr old Spaniard reached the semifinals at the pre-Wimby tournament in Queens. He had a very tough obstacle there in the like of the first seed and home player, Andy Murray. He lost pretty convincingly (6:2, 6:4), but that didn’t prevent him from continuing his solid play on grass. So far he’s had some really tough opponents at Wimbledon, but he dealt with them quite solid. Firstly he convincingly defeated both Youzhny and Santoro, just to face a real threat against Fernando Gonzalez, who took him to five sets. However, the Spaniard dealt with him eventually, winning the fifth set by 6:4 and ensuring the 4th round. Already warmed-up Frenchie Simon awaited him there, but to everyone’s surprise, Ferrero defeated him quite fast in straight sets (7:6, 6:3, 6:2). He is aware who his next obstacle on the way to the semifinals and his best career result regarding grass surfaces is. But, Ferrero would’ve never even been a champion if he didn’t have the faith, so he will surely not give up easily and will do his best to record a big upset.
